Hello,
I would like to know if it is possible to add an msa1000 in an existing SAN topologie (2 DS-DSGGC-AA switch, ma8000, windows servers)the volumes on the msa1000 will be connected to a new blade server.

Hi Gerard,
Yes, you can attach MSA1000 together with ma8000 on the same SAN. The switches that you have are 1Gbps switches (SC connectors) and MSA1000 has 2Gbps LC ports. So what you need to do is purchase SC/LC cables and attach MSA1000 to your switches. If you are using Zoning create new zone for MSA1000 and servers attached to it.
